At the time of the … Information about Publication 527, Residential Rental Property, including … The Interactive Tax Assistant (ITA) is a tool that provides answers to several tax law … WebThe landlord should properly charge only $200 for the two years’ worth of life (use) that would have remained if the tenant had not damaged the carpet. Original cost of carpet:: $1,000 Expected life of carpet: 10 years Depreciation charge ($1,000 / 10): $100 per year Age of carpet: 8 years Carpet Life Years Remaining: 10 years – 8 years = 2 years

WebOct 1, 2024 · Taxpayers generally must capitalize amounts paid to improve a unit of property. A unit of property is improved if the cost is made for (1) a betterment to the unit of property; (2) a restoration of the unit of property; or (3) an adaptation of the unit of property to a new or different use (Regs. Sec. 1.263(a)-3 (d)).Observation: The … smart cycle pedal https://keonna.net
